As the 2024-25 season draws to a close, seeing the women's team firmly on the bubble, it's important to take stock of what we currently have on the roster and what we see coming in.
It's true, we are losing Rose Micheaux and Tilly Ekh, who, over the last two seasons for the Hokies, accounted for a combined 109 starts, 20.2 points, 9.1 rebounds, and 3.1 assists per game.
But what do we return?
The lone rising Senior on the roster is Lani White, a former ProspectsNation Top 150 recruit in the 2022 class. White has been a consistent double-digit scorer who has also proven to be reliable from the FT line at 83%

Kate Sears averaged 27.2 points, 13.1 rebounds and 9.2 assists. She shot 39.4% from the 3-point line and 81% at the free-throw line. She had 13 triple-doubles.
For her career, Sears finished with 2,614 points, 980 rebounds and 714 assists in 116 games. Her career points rank 11th in N.C. history.

Golden State Warriors star Stephen Curry has accepted a role with his alma mater Davidson College as an assistant general manager for the basketball programs, university officials told ESPN.
Curry becomes the first active player in U.S. major professional sports to take an administrative job with an NCAA team.
In his new role, Curry, who played three seasons at Davidson (2006-09), will provide guidance to the men's and women's teams based on his college and professional experience.

Hokies go to South Carina to take on the most punchable coavhing face in the ACC, Brad Brownell.
Brownell has the Tigers tracking for a 3 seed in the NCAA Tournament. Clemson is led by someone that has been there as long as R.J. Davis has been at UNC. 6th year Senior Chase Hunter is putting up 16.4 ppg as one of four seniors putting up double-digit averages. Chauncey Wiggins, 6'10 Forward is the only Junior in the starting lineup. The Tigers typically only go 8 deep.
Clemson simply shoots better than it's opponents. They average over 52% inside the perimeter and 39% outside. They are also shooting 77% from the line. Their average margin of victory is almost 11 points per game.
